全面解析被墙V2Ray的安装与配置

什么是V2Ray?

V2Ray 是一款先进的网络代理工具,旨在帮助用户保护个人隐私并绕过网络限制。作为一个开源项目,V2Ray 提供了强大的功能与灵活的配置选项,使其成为被墙的用户的理想选择。

V2Ray的优势

  1. 隐私保护:V2Ray 通过多重加密和混淆技术,保护用户的数据不被泄露。
  2. 灵活性:用户可以根据需要配置不同的传输协议,以满足特定需求。
  3. 高性能:V2Ray 具备较低的延迟和较高的吞吐量,适合各种网络环境使用。
  4. 开源:作为一个开源项目,V2Ray 得到了广泛的社区支持与更新。

V2Ray的基本原理

V2Ray 采用分布式架构,其中主要组件包括:

  • 核心:负责协议解析和数据转发
  • 入站代理:接收外部请求
  • 出站代理:将请求转发到目标地址
  • 配置文件:用户通过 JSON 格式配置用于指定代理规则

如何下载与安装V2Ray

Windows用户

  1. 前往 V2Ray 官网 下载适用于 Windows 的安装包。
  2. 解压下载的文件。
  3. 运行命令提示符,并进入解压目录。
  4. 输入 v2ray.exe 以启动 V2Ray。

macOS 用户

  1. 使用 Homebrew 安装:在终端中输入 brew install v2ray
  2. 或访问官网下载适用于 macOS 的安装包并按照说明进行安装。

Linux用户

  1. 使用 wget 下载 V2Ray:wget https://github.com/v2ray/v2ray-core/releases/latest/download/v2ray-linux-64.zip
  2. 解压并进入解压目录,使用命令 ./v2ray 启动。

V2Ray的基本配置

编辑配置文件

V2Ray 使用 JSON 格式的配置文件,通常名为 config.json。以下是一个简单的配置示例:

{
“outbounds”: [
{
“protocol”: “vmess”,
“settings”: {
“servers”: [
{
“address”: “your.server.address”,
“port”: 10086,
“users”: [
{
“id”: “uuid-goes-here”,
“alterId”: 64
}
]
}
]
}
}
],
“inbounds”: [
{
“port”: 1080,
“protocol”: “socks”,
“settings”: {
“auth”: “noauth”,
“udp”: true,
“ip”: “127.0.0.1”
}
}
]
}

启动V2Ray

  1. 确保已保存 config.json 文件。
  2. 再次打开命令提示符 (或终端),并运行 v2ray
  3. 检查是否正常启动,确保没有错误信息输出。

常见问题解答

V2Ray与VPN的区别是什么?

  • 协议和功能:V2Ray 提供多种传输协议,而 VPN 主要基于 IPsec、L2TP 等通用协议。
  • 隐私保护:V2Ray 更强调在隐私保护方面的灵活性与多样性,而大多数 VPN 提供的是集中式的服务。在数据处理上更容易受到监管。

如何确保V2Ray的安全性?

  • 使用复杂的 UUID /密钥,避免使用默认值。
  • 经常更新 V2Ray 到最新版本,以修复已知的安全漏洞。
  • 使用合理的加密算法,增强数据的安全性。

V2Ray是否适用所有地区?

  • V2Ray 在大多数地区均可使用,但某些国家可能会对其进行封锁。请用户根据当地法律法规合理使用。

如果V2Ray连接失败,应该怎么处理?

  • 检查配置文件是否正确,特定字段应填写准确。
  • 确认网络正常,尝试通过其他网络连接 V2Ray。
  • 查看 V2Ray 的日志文件,定位错误信息。

结论

V2Ray 是绕过网络限制和保护隐私的强大工具。通过正确的安装和配置,可以显著改善用户的网络访问体验。希望本文能为广大用户提供实用的指导与帮助。

正文完
 0